Scheepers through in France

Paris - Qualifier Chanelle Scheepers became the first South African woman in more than six years to win a Grand Slam match when she reached the second round of the French Open by beating Mathilde Johansson on Sunday.

The 131st-ranked Scheepers posted her first ever victory at a Grand Slam event by defeating France's Johansson 6-2, 6-4.

Amanda Coetzer was the last woman from South Africa to win a match at a Grand Slam when she made the second round at the Australian Open in 2004.

No South African had reached the second round in the women's draw at Roland Garros since Coetzer and Joannette Kruger nine years ago.

The 26-year-old Scheepers - the highest-ranked player from South Africa - is making her third Grand Slam main-draw appearance. She lost to Elena Dementieva in the first round last year at Roland Garros.

Scheepers will next face Argentina's Gisela Dulko, who upset 10th-seeded Victoria Azarenka of Belarus 6-1, 6-2.

"I know that she's already won four matches because she qualified in the qualifying round," Dulko said. "My brother watched her match today so he's going to give me feedback. I'll take time to analyze her game."

Singles Results (x denotes seeding):

Men - First Round


Alejandro Falla (COL) bt Janko Tipsarevic (SRB) 6-1, 6-2, 6-3
Marin Cilic (CRO x10) bt Ricardo Mello (BRA) 6-1, 3-6, 6-3, 6-1
Mikhail Youzhny (RUS x11) bt Michal Przysiezny (POL) 6-1, 6-0, 6-4
Thiemo de Bakker (NED) bt Olivier Patience (FRA) 6-4, 5-7, 6-4, 6-3
Robin Soderling (SWE x5) bt Laurent Recouderc (FRA) 6-0, 6-2, 6-3
Fabio Fognini (ITA) bt Nicolas Massu (CHI) 6-1, 3-6, 2-6, 6-3, 6-3
Albert Montanes (ESP x29) bt Stefano Galvani (ITA) 6-3, 6-3, 6-3
Guilermo Garcia-Lopez (ESP x32) bt Rainer Schuettler (GER) 7-5, 6-4, 6-2
Julien Benneteau (FRA) bt Ernests Gulbis (LAT x23) 6-4, 6-2, 1-0 - retired

Women - First Round

Svetlana Kuznetsova (RUS x6) bt Sorana Cirstea (ROM) 6-3, 6-1
Chanelle Scheepers (RSA) bt Mathilde Johansson (FRA) 6-2, 6-4
Dominika Cibulkova (SVK x26) bt Ekaterina Ivanova (RUS) 6-2, 6-0
Andrea Petkovic (GER) bt Elena Vesnina (RUS) 4-6, 6-1, 6-4
Varvara Lepchenko (USA) bt Christina McHale (USA) 7-5, 6-3
Gisela Dulko (ARG) bt Victoria Azarenka (BLR x10) 6-1, 6-2
Aravane Rezai (FRA x15) bt Heidi El Tabakh (CAN) 6-1, 6-1
Flavia Pennetta (ITA x14) bt Anne Keothavon (GBR) 6-2, 6-2
Akgul Amanmuradova (UZB) bt Maria Jose Martinez Sanchez (ESP x20) 6-2, 6-4
Yvonne Meusburger (AUT) bt Claire Feuerstein (FRA) 7-6 (7/4), 6-3
Maria Kirilenko (RUS x30) bt Karolina Sprem (CRO) 7-6 (7/5), 6-4
Johanna Larsson (SWE) bt Anastasija Sevastova (LAT) 6-2, 6-2
